Product Description

 Fiber optic gyroscope inclinometer is a inclinometer that uses fiber optic gyroscope element to determine the inclination Angle of borehole. Application of fiber optic gyroscope in gyRO inclinometer: It is usually necessary to use gyro inclinometer to measure the inclinometer azimuth value in cased-well skylight and old well retest. In abnormal magnetic field areas and well sections, due to the large error of the fluxgate measurement value, gyro inclinometer is also needed to measure the azimuth value. In addition, in some specific circumstances, such as the high frequency of solar magnetic storms, or the need for a third instrument to verify the occasion, gyro inclinometer also has its unique role

Application & Features of North-Seeking Gyro Inclinometer Borehole Fiber Optic Gyroscope Gyroscopic Non-magnetic Multi-shot Inclinometer

 
GBY-2GW Wireless Fiber Optic North-Finder Gyro inclinometer is a new kind of digital instruments which is designed to measure the magnetic boreholes without cable. It is widely used in engineering, hydrology, water and electricity, coal, metallurgy, oil and geological areas.

GBY-2GW Digital North-Finder Gyro inclinometer integrates tilt sensor, Gyroscope and advanced microchip processor technology into a single instrument basic on the traditional technology. It offers digital display on ground controller and it is easy to operate. The GBY-2GW is designed to measure the magnetic rock bedding and mine whose diameter is larger than Ø46mm.

The gyro inclinometer consists of two main parts, the survey tool itself and an Android controller which is used to operate and present the borehole survey data. There is a lithium battery inside the probe for the survey tool to get power. To connect to the portable controller, turn on the survey tool and the Android controller, then the App should automatically detect the GDY-2GW and you are ready to start your survey. The GDY-2GW measure the self-rotation (about 15°/hour) of the earth to seek the True North. It is required to input the local latitude to calculate the Azimuth angle.
